Requirements
  • Over 5 years of experience in research, development, and commercialization of wake-up words.
  • Experience in knowledge distillation and inference optimization for small models.
  • Proficiency in Pytorch, as well as libtorch, onnx, and other on-device libraries, and familiarity with writing C++ code.
  • Korean language proficiency in professional research or work
Responsibilities
  • Develop and refine models for common wake-up words such as "Hey Hyundai," "Hey Kia," "Hey Genesis," and future wake-up words planned for development and commercialization.
  • Collect or curate diverse intonation data from native speakers and use it to develop a localized wake-up word detector.
  • Gather hard negative words commonly used in the local region and integrate them into the modeling process.
  • Quickly implement the latest wake-up word technologies into real-world services and collaboratively develop technology and code for application in other locales.
  • Actively communicate and troubleshoot with the Korean headquarters and Hyundai Motor Company-related entities to ensure accurate support for North American wake-up words.

42dot.ai operates in the smart mobility and urban transportation sector, offering an integrated platform known as UMOS (Urban Mobility Operating System). This platform connects various modes of transportation, such as cars and drones, into a unified system, allowing for efficient management and optimization of urban transport. UMOS utilizes advanced technologies to provide services like transportation management, demand response, and smart logistics. The primary clients include city governments, transportation agencies, and private companies seeking to improve their mobility solutions. Unlike competitors, 42dot.ai focuses on a subscription-based model for its platform, allowing clients to pay based on the services they use. The goal of 42dot.ai is to enhance operational efficiency, reduce costs, and improve the user experience for commuters and logistics providers, ultimately contributing to the development of smarter cities.
